Abstract: A hybrid control scheme for vibration control of smart beams is
presented in which the passive control method is used to suppress the vibration with large
amplitude by taking advantage of the supper elasticity of shape memory alloy, and the
active control method is used simultaneously to perform precise control by using
distributed segmented piezoelectric sensors and actuators. The simulation results show
that control effect of the hybrid method is much better than that of the distributed
piezoelectric element method itself.
